Country Fried Soul: Adventures in Dirty South Hip Hop

Hip-hop is the biggest youth movement in the world today and leading the way is the new sound of the South exemplified by platinum and multi-platinum artists like OutKast Lil Jon & The East Side Boyz Ludacris Ying Yang Twins and 8Ball and MJG. This fascinating book reveals where Dirty South hip-hop came from and where it’s heading. It explores the hopes struggles and frustrations of performers and producers and guides you to the best in Southern hip-hop on CD and DVD in magazines and on the web. If you want to know where the South is taking music you need this book. Includes foreword by Mississippi rapper David Banner.
